Ticket: Config drift on the Haldane garage occupancy feed. The Ostermill node is publishing counts every 5s while the other three garages publish every 15s, which skews the aggregation window downstream in Lotgrid. Someone hot-patched the interval during the holiday surge and never reverted. Please review the diff and restore parity across all nodes. The intended baseline configuration is as follows.

settings of kahip-hafop:
ralix:
  log_level: warn
  metrics_host: metrics.ralix.zemvarsys.internal
  pin: 8273
  pool_size: 8

### CI Note: Consent Banner Rollout Failures

If the Bramblewick consent-banner job fails in CI, it's almost always the locale snapshot step. The banner copy is fetched from the Tessel translation service at build time, and stale snapshots cause a diff failure, not a real regression. Re-run `make consent-snapshots` locally and commit the result. Do not disable the check; legal review in Varnholt requires every banner variant to be pinned per release. If failures persist after a snapshot refresh, escalate with the build token below.

build token for kahop-kagag: htk31_38a3512afc721db8009f808ec553b14

Heads up: the nightly inventory reconciliation job on Crateloft keeps flaking when the warehouse snapshot lands late. It's not a code bug — the diff step just races the snapshot import. If you see phantom shortages for the Delvane depot, rerun after 02:30 and it clears. We added a retry gate but it's crude. The failing run's trace token is pasted below.

trace token, fafog-kageg: htk4_98e6